PEOPLE EX REL. GUAR. TRUST CO. v. BOYLAND


281 A.D. 654 (1952)

The People of the State of New York ex rel. Guaranty Trust Company of New York, as Trustee under The Will of Elmer E. Smathers, Deceased, Respondent, v. William E. Boyland et al., Constituting The Tax Commission of the City of New York, Appellants. [562 Fifth Ave., Borough of Manhattan.]

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, First Department.

December 9, 1952.


Order unanimously modified to fix the assessed valuation for the land for the tax year 1946-1947 at $600,000, and for the tax years 1947-1948, 1948-1949, 1949-1950 and 1950-1951 at $625,000 and, as so modified, affirmed, with $20 costs and disbursements to the appellants. The land valuations fixed herein are sustained by the evidence in the record. Settle order...
